Does Regent Security Offer Live Cctv Monitoring in the Lower Mainland?
Regent Security provides professional live CCTV monitoring services throughout Vancouver and the Lower Mainland, including Surrey and Burnaby. These services offer 24/7 real-time surveillance specifically designed for commercial properties, construction sites, and hotels.
Key features of the service include:
- Regional and Scalable Solutions: Monitoring covers diverse areas such as Downtown Vancouver, Yaletown, and Kitsilano with flexible protocols tailored to urban challenges.
- Rapid Deployment: With a team of over 100 trained professionals, the company can often provide same-day deployment for urgent security needs.
- Advanced Technology: Systems include high-resolution cameras with night vision, AI-powered detection for threat management, and secure platforms for remote access anytime and anywhere.
- Legal Compliance: All services are fully licensed and insured, operating in strict accordance with the Security Services Act and other British Columbia regulations.
The monitoring integrates seamlessly with on-site guarding and access control systems to enhance loss prevention and ensure rapid response to potential threats. Interested parties can schedule a free site assessment to receive a customized security quote.
